## Deployment

Vexgauge profiles GPU memory on the inference fleet. Deploy only after the model servers are drained; the profiler pins device contexts and will break live traffic otherwise. Release manager: tag the build, push to the Orvane registry, then roll nodes one rack at a time. Verify the sampler interval before enabling alerts. The agent must start with exactly these configuration values.

settings of fafog-haduf:
ZORIX_PIN=4648
ZORIX_METRICS_HOST=metrics.zorix.paliqsys.corp
ZORIX_LOG_LEVEL=info
ZORIX_TENANT=druix

Alert: PinPoint address autocomplete widget error rate above 5% for 10 minutes. Likely causes: upstream geocoder timeout or stale suggestion cache. Support should advise customers to enter addresses manually; do not restart the widget service yourself. If customer reports persist beyond 30 minutes, notify the widget team at the address below.

billing contact of kagaf-bahif = fraox_ralvan_tamwyn@zemvarcloud.local

**Ticket: Vault locked — Bouncewright bounce processor**

The credentials vault for Bouncewright sealed itself after three failed unseal attempts during last night's deploy, so the bounce processor cannot fetch its mailbox tokens and hard bounces are queuing. As the new contractor on rotation, please follow the unseal checklist carefully and verify quorum with the platform steward before proceeding. The recovery passphrase for the emergency unseal is below.

unlock words, kagef-taduf: fenir-quenix-norwyn-sorvan-gormir-gorir-fraok

**14:22 UTC** — The Lintfall scanner at Quarrel Systems began flagging legitimate packages as typo-squats after a ruleset sync pulled a truncated dictionary. Support saw a spike in false-positive tickets within minutes. We rolled back to the prior ruleset at 14:41 and confirmed clean scans. The affected scanner build is recorded below.

build token for tahop-fafof: htk14_2d55df8101eccc